Brief Summary

Surface Electromyography can be utilised to detect normal muscle electrical activity during maximum forward flexion termed Flexion Relaxation Response (FRR)

Study Population

Patients with low back pain who were being referred to the rehabilitation outpatient in University Malaya Medical Centre between November 2019 until July 2020.

You may qualify if:

  • Participants aged between 20 - 70 years old
  • Mechanical LBP \> 6 weeks (not acute LBP)
  • Not received any specific exercise spinal manipulation or surgery to improve LBP within the last 3 months.

You may not qualify if:

  • Pregnancy
  • Radicular LBP patients or specific-spinal pathology / "red-flags".
  • Surgical intervention for the current LBP complaint (includes traumatic causes of LBP with surgical intervention)
  • Cognitive or communication difficulty preventing active participation in exercises or communicating pain scores
